Can't really compare the viscous coupler to a locked center diff. If you lock the center diff, you really shouldn't run the vehicle on pavement... you can, but you'll feel tire bite and put a lot of wear on the drive train. The viscous coupler allows the axles to spin at different speeds, but if one starts to slip/spin much faster than the other, torque is transferred to the slower spinning axle. If the center diff were truly "open" with no type of viscous coupler/limited slip, what would be the point? A single wheel losing traction at either axle would get all the torque... I would think this type of system would be worse than a 2 wheel drive vehicle.

I could not see any "full time" LC having no viscous coupler. You'd have less reliable traction than an open diff 2wd vehicle.

In slick conditions:

2wd open diff, effectively 1 wheel drive: when either driven wheel (2) slips, all torque stays at that wheel.

4wd full time, 3 open diffs, effectively 1 wheel drive: when any driven wheel slips (4), all torque stays at that wheel. You have double the chance to get a driven wheel slipping with this setup vs. 2wd open diff! yikes!

4wd full time, VC center and open F/R, effectively 2 wheel drive: when a wheel slips, torque is transferred to the opposite axle.

4wd locked center, open F/R, effectively 2 wheel drive: when a wheel slips torque remains the same to each axle.

Of these setups, only the 4wd with VC actively changes the amount of torque an axle sees. This is why I'd think packed snow / ice driving is probably safest without locking the center diff, what do you all think?
